From: TEP SNORD12B, SNORA63, and SNORD14E as novel biomarkers for hepatitis B virus-related hepatocellular carcinoma (HBV-related HCC)

Fig. 1

Aberrant expression of TEP SNORD12B, SNORA63, and SNORD14E in HBV-related HCC. (A) The SNORic database was used to analyze the differential expression of SNORD12B, SNORA63, and SNORD14E in cancer and adjacent tissues. (B) Differential expression of platelet SNORD12B, SNORA63, and SNORD14E in 117 healthy individuals and 117 patients with HBV-related HCC. The expression level of snoRNAs in the database is represented by log2 (FPKM + 1). (HD: healthy donors; FPKM: fragments per kilobase of exon model per million mapped fragments; ****p < 0.0001)
